Output a84a497f856afacd285a5d779bb40b1baa6d4a979f99d0d838c5bc40fde0327e:10

value
1226853597
script pubkey
OP_0 OP_PUSHBYTES_20 8dd68842e29e819b51b4a53c5ae9ebcdc7e07f85
address
tb1q3htgsshzn6qek5d55579460tehr7qlu9whesaf
transaction
a84a497f856afacd285a5d779bb40b1baa6d4a979f99d0d838c5bc40fde0327e
confirmations
131143
spent
true